- as eternal as heaven and earth
This phrase conveys a sense of something being everlasting or without end, akin to the infinite nature of the universe. It is often used in solemn or poetic contexts to emphasize the timelessness of certain concepts, relationships, or ideas.
I believe this friendship is as eternal as heaven and earth.
